Baconian

Baconian ({not transcribed}) , adjective

Of or pertaining to Lord Francis Bacon, or to his system of philosophy.

Baconian , noun

1.
One who adheres to the philosophy of Lord Bacon.
2.
One who maintains that Lord Bacon is the author of the works commonly attributed to Shakespeare.

Baconian method , the inductive method. See Induction.
